Title: Demitris Bloody Mary duck
Post by: Camp David on May 03, 2011, 01:40:46 PM
marinate your duck breasts in Demitris Bloody Mary mix (www.demitris.com (http://www.demitris.com)) over night. If the breasts are larger (mallard, or goose) slice them in 1/2 first. Cook some bacon till it is almost done. On a hot grill cook each side of the duck breast about 4 minutes (still pink in the center). Wrap with bacon and grill about another minute.  :EAT:

I'm cookin' this tonight! The wife has plans to be away, so I'm batchn it. I went to Cash & Carry yesterday and got a coupla bottles of the chilis and peppers. Had a bufflehead and 1/2 mallard drake thawing during the day. Got home and breasted 'em out (the mallard more thinly), poked some holes in the breasts with a fork. Put 'em in a container and poured 1/2 a bottle over 'em (enough to cover everything). Sealed it up and shook it up. It's marinating right now.
